Analysis

In 2020, labor share of gdp in Tanzania stood at 53.3. That is the highest value across all 17 years on record.

That represents a change of up 3.3% on the previous year and up 96.0% over ten years.

Over the whole period, labor share of gdp in Tanzania peaked at 53.3 in 2020 and was at its lowest, 27.2, in 2010.

That places Tanzania 63rd out of 186 countries with data for 2020, putting it in the middle of the range.

The long-run direction has been consistently rising across the 17 years of available data.
